Enumeration for MSO-Queries on Compressed Trees

Summary: Linear preprocessing and output-linear-delay enumeration for MSO queries on grammar-based compressed trees, with time measured in the size of the compressed grammar. Generalizes MSO enumeration on uncompressed trees and compressed-text spanners to tree grammars. (summarized by gpt-5-mini on Feb 09 2026)
